Our projects encompass advising on the decommissioning of the first-generation nuclear power stations as well as the construction of the new wave of power plants that are being planned and built around the world. In 2009 our technical competency and knowledge was recognised with the award of a contract for a series of technical services under the framework agreement for the UK’s Nuclear Installation Inspectorate. The technical services – including internal hazards, probabilistic safety analysis and management for safety and quality assurance – relate to the generic design assessment for the UK’s new-build nuclear reactor programme.

Lloyd’s Register has led the way on verification solutions for the nuclear industry, providing expertise and knowledge to assess duty holder schemes and monitoring structure management. This level of thought-leadership approach includes technical assessment work, which also helps harness best practice in guiding regulation.  We have been associated with over 85 nuclear projects worldwide.  Our UK nuclear involvement began in the 50s with the Calder Hall reactors, through being the independent Third Party Inspection Authority for Sizewell B. Today we provide services across the full nuclear fuel cycle.
